TRADITIONAL CHINESE MEDICINE (TCM): A complete system of medicine with its own form of diagnosis, treatment, prognosis, and therapies. TCM views the body as an energetic system in dynamic balance of the Qi, which can be translated as energy or life force, it flows in a regular pattern through a system of channels -or meridians- to all parts of the body.
When the flow of Qi is unimpeded there is harmony, balance, and good health. When there are exccesses, deficiencies or blockages of Qi, there is a signal of disharmony and disease.
TCM helps to restore the body's balance by working on an energetic level affecting all aspects of the person. The beauty of this system is that could be used to correct imbalances that have become illness, or correct imbalances prior to the appearance of symptoms, preventing disease.
TCM is the longest existing continuous medical system practiced in the word, with over 3000 years of history.

CUPPING THERAPY: Method of using glass or plastic cups to create localized pressure by a vacuum. It is known as a “bankings” and helps to release energetic stagnation and restores the normal flow of Qi and blood.
GUASHA: “Gua” means to scrape and “Sha” means toxins. During the session, the practitioner will use a special tool to gently scrape the skin and stimulate circulation.
Gua Sha treatment improves the flow of the life energy (Qi). It can help with chronic pain, poor circulation, fatigue, infections and emotional stress.
MOXIBUSTION: The process whereby a dried herb is burned indirectly above the skin over specific acupuncture points, or the herbs is attached to the Acupuncture needles and then burned in order to warm the needle. This is used to warm the Qi and the Blood in the meridians.
LASER ACUPUNCTURE: Light stimulation instead of needles is used. May be used in combination with the regular Acupuncture treatment. Suitable for children or needle-phobic patients.
ELECTROACUPUNCTURE: As with traditional Acupuncture, needles are inserted on specific points along the body. The needles are then attached to a device that generates continuous electric pulses using small clips. These devices are used to adjust the frequency and intensity of the impulse being delivered, depending on the condition being treated. Electroacupuncture uses two needles at a time so that the impulses can pass from one needle to the other. Several pairs of needles can be stimulated simultaneously, usually for no more than 30 minutes at a time.

TUINA MASSAGE: Tuina literally translates “to push – to grasp”, and is the name given to Chinese Medical Massage. Tuina uses techniques and manipulations to stimulate meridians, acupuncture points or other parts of the body surface so as to correct physiological imbalances of the body and achieve curative effects. Tuina is an important part of TCM.
